Within an hour or two, you're really going to have to work at finding someone with land. Bunch of deer in Brazoria, Austin, Matagorda, and Colorado Counties, but not many (any) public options.

Somerville WMA is a good option in Burleson County, but I believe it's a drawn hunt.

Lots of places for lease in Hardin and Liberty County on timber land for fairly cheap. These places are hunted fairly heavy opening week and Thanksgiving and Christmas. Other than that most aren't hunted. Quality of deer is not awesome but can be good if you put in some time. Hogs are plentiful.
